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
34 881451 92945151
89 7246805867
89 7246805867
8646417 95412 84543495
All about undefined
Interested in learning more?
89 7246805867
8646417 95412 84543495
See more
6397 3853
50276042 76012300638 399
See more
88 27
9746 8802372636 94505784227 36532752
See more